description Park City Mountain Overview
As the largest single ski resort in the United States, Park City Mountain offers staggering variety with over 7,300 acres of terrain. Its unique advantage is direct, ski-in/ski-out access from the historic and vibrant Main Street of Park City. The resort features everything from gentle beginner areas to demanding expert bowls and one of the world's most renowned terrain park complexes. As a key Epic Pass resort, it provides excellent value for pass holders.
It's an ideal destination for groups and families with mixed abilities, offering a perfect blend of extensive on-mountain options and a genuine, accessible town with Olympic heritage.
info Park City Mountain Specifications
| Number Of Runs | 168 |
| Elevation Range | 2,940 - 9,000 feet |
| Number Of Lifts | 25 |
| Total Skiable Terrain | 7,300 acres |
balance Park City Mountain Pros & Cons
- Over 7,300 acres of skiable terrain
- Ski-in/ski-out access from Main Street
- Variety of slopes for all skill levels
- Proximity to Park City's amenities and attractions
- Limited night skiing hours compared to some resorts
- Higher lift ticket prices than regional competitors
- Crowded trails during peak seasons
- Less snowmaking coverage on lower elevation runs
